Break-glass access — Addrly autocomplete widget (plugin authors). If the sandbox credential service is down and your plugin cannot fetch suggestion data, break-glass access is available. Use it only when normal auth has failed twice and the status page confirms an outage. Break-glass grants read-only access to the suggestion index for four hours and is fully logged; abuse revokes your plugin listing. To invoke it, run the breakglass CLI from your plugin workspace and enter the recovery passphrase printed below.

strongbox words: sorir-belvan-rusix-ulays-ralmir-praix-eliir-tamax-praael-druael-julir-tamius-jorir

## Introduce per-tenant rate quotas in the Orvane gateway

For the release manager: this change replaces our global throttle with per-tenant quotas, resolved at request time from the tenant registry and cached for sixty seconds. Tenants without an explicit quota inherit the tier default; overage returns a retryable status with a hint header. Rollout is gated behind a flag, defaulting off, and the old throttle remains as a backstop until two clean release cycles pass.

The initial tier defaults we intend to ship are listed below.

limits module of taguf-hafog:
WEIGHTS = {
    "wenox": 690,
    "wenok": 782,
    "kelax": 41,
    "holox": 338,
    "quenir": 39,
}

## Retry failed exports

Exports to the Drellin archive sometimes time out and were silently dropped. This adds automatic retries with backoff, so support no longer needs to manually requeue. Failed jobs now retry up to the cap, then land in the dead-letter queue for review. The tuning constants are as follows.

limits module of tawep-hawif:
WEIGHTS = {
    "sordor": 228,
    "kasax": 458,
    "ulaox": 8,
    "casix": 495,
    "briix": 335,
}